Microsoft Excel — это не просто табличный редактор, а мощный инструмент для анализа данных, где умение быстро и точно выделять нужные области экономит часы работы. Начинающие пользователи часто теряют время на ручное выделение каждой ячейки, в то время как профессионалы используют горячие клавиши, именованные диапазоны и даже макросы для автоматизации. Эта статья раскроет все способы выделения — от базовых до продвинутых, с учетом нюансов разных версий Excel (2010–2026).
Вы научитесь выделять не только отдельные ячейки или столбцы, но и динамические диапазоны, которые автоматически расширяются при добавлении данных, а также освоите приемы для работы с скрытыми строками и защищенными листами. Особое внимание уделено типичным ошибкам — например, почему иногда выделение «сбивается» при прокрутке или как избежать случайного изменения формул при групповом выделении.
1. Базовые способы выделения мышкой
Начнем с азов: как выделить область в Excel с помощью мыши. Этот метод интуитивно понятен, но даже здесь есть нюансы, которые ускоряют работу.
Чтобы выделить одиночную ячейку, просто кликните по ней левой кнопкой мыши. Для выделения диапазона ячеек:
- 🖱️ Зажмите левую кнопку мыши на первой ячейке диапазона и протяните курсор до последней ячейки. Область будет подсвечена синим.
- 📌 Чтобы выделить несколько несмежных областей, удерживайте клавишу
Ctrl(или⌘на Mac) и кликайте по нужным ячейкам или диапазонам. - 🔍 Для выделения всей таблицы нажмите на серый треугольник в левом верхнем углу (между заголовками строк и столбцов).
Если нужно выделить столбец или строку целиком, кликните по их заголовку (букве столбца или номеру строки). Для выделения нескольких столбцов/строк удерживайте Shift или Ctrl при клике по заголовкам.
2. Горячие клавиши для быстрого выделения
Клавиатурные комбинации экономят время, особенно при работе с большими таблицами. Вот ключевые сочетания:
| Действие | Комбинация клавиш (Windows) | Комбинация клавиш (Mac) |
|---|---|---|
| Выделить всю таблицу | Ctrl + A (дважды для выделения всех данных) | ⌘ + A |
| Выделить текущую строку | Shift + Пробел | Shift + Пробел |
| Выделить текущий столбец | Ctrl + Пробел | ⌘ + Пробел |
| Выделить до последней заполненной ячейки в строке | Ctrl + Shift + → | ⌘ + Shift + → |
| Выделить до последней заполненной ячейки в столбце | Ctrl + Shift + ↓ | ⌘ + Shift + ↓ |
Особенно полезна комбинация Ctrl + Shift + →/↓ — она позволяет мгновенно выделить непрерывный блок данных без пустых ячеек. Например, если в столбце A данные идут до строки 100, а затем пустота до строки 200, Excel выделит только заполненные ячейки (A1:A100).
Важно: в Excel Online и мобильной версии некоторые комбинации могут не работать или требовать дополнительных действий (например, сначала нажать Fn).
3. Выделение с помощью функции «Перейти» (F5)
Функция Перейти (или Go To) позволяет выделять диапазоны по их адресу или имени. Это удобно для работы с большими листами, где прокрутка занимает много времени.
Чтобы воспользоваться функцией:
- Нажмите
F5илиCtrl + G(или перейдите вГлавная → Найти и выделить → Перейти). - В поле
Ссылкавведите адрес диапазона (например,A1:D50) или его имя (если оно задано). - Нажмите
Enter— область будет выделена автоматически.
Этот метод незаменим, если нужно выделить невидимые ячейки (например, скрытые строки или столбцы). Также он полезен для работы с именованными диапазонами, о которых пойдет речь далее.
Как выделить все ячейки с формулами на листе?
Откройте Перейти (F5), нажмите Выделить… → Формулы → ОК. Excel подсветит все ячейки, содержащие формулы, включая скрытые.
4. Именованные диапазоны: выделение по имени
Именованные диапазоны — это присвоенные пользователем имена для ячеек или областей (например, Продажи_2026 вместо B2:B100). Они упрощают навигацию и выделение, особенно в больших проектах.
Чтобы создать именованный диапазон:
- Выделите нужную область.
- В поле
Имя(слева от строки формул) введите название (например,Клиенты_VIP). - Нажмите
Enter.
Теперь для выделения этого диапазона достаточно:
- 🔤 Ввести его имя в поле
Имяи нажатьEnter. - 📌 Использовать функцию
Перейти(F5) и выбрать имя из списка. - 🖱️ Кликнуть по имени в
Диспетчере имен(Формулы → Диспетчер имен).
Именованные диапазоны также упрощают работу с формулами. Например, вместо =СУММ(B2:B100) можно написать =СУММ(Продажи_2026), что делает формулы более читаемыми.
Имя не содержит пробелов (используйте "_")
Первый символ — буква или "_"
Имя уникально для книги
Диапазон не содержит пустых строк/столбцов (если это критично)
-->
5. Выделение динамических диапазонов (с автоматическим расширением)
Статичные диапазоны (например, A1:A100) перестают быть актуальными при добавлении новых данных. Динамические диапазоны автоматически подстраиваются под изменения, что особенно важно для сводных таблиц и графиков.
Создать динамический диапазон можно двумя способами:
- С помощью таблиц Excel:
- Выделите данные и нажмите
Ctrl + T(илиВставка → Таблица). - Excel автоматически создаст таблицу с динамическим диапазоном. Теперь при добавлении строки в конец таблицы диапазон расширится.
- Выделите данные и нажмите
Используйте функцию СМЕЩ (или OFFSET в английской версии) для создания именованного диапазона, который будет автоматически изменять размер. Например:
=СМЕЩ(Лист1!$A$1;0;0;СЧЁТЗ(Лист1!$A:$A);1)
Эта формула создает диапазон, который начинается с A1 и расширяется вниз до последней непустой ячейки в столбце A.
Динамические диапазоны незаменимы для автоматического обновления графиков. Если источник данных для графика — динамический диапазон, то при добавлении новых строк график обновится без ручного вмешательства.
6. Выделение скрытых строк, столбцов и защищенных листов
Работа со скрытыми элементами и защищенными листами требует особого подхода. Вот как выделить то, что не видно на первый взгляд:
Скрытые строки/столбцы:
- 👁️ Чтобы выделить скрытую строку, кликните по заголовкам видимых строк до и после скрытой, удерживая
Shift. Например, если скрыта строка 5, выделите строки 4 и 6. - 📊 Для выделения скрытого столбца действуйте аналогично: выделите соседние столбцы (например,
BиD, если скрытC).
Защищенные листы:
- 🔒 Если лист защищен, вы не сможете выделить заблокированные ячейки. Сначала снимите защиту:
Рецензирование → Снять защиту листа(потребуется пароль). - 🔓 Чтобы выделить только разблокированные ячейки на защищенном листе, используйте
Перейти → Выделить… → Ячейки без блокировки.
⚠️ Внимание: При выделении скрытых строк/столбцов через соседние ячейки Excel может «забыть» о скрытых данных при копировании. Всегда проверяйте буфер обмена (Главная → Буфер обмена) перед вставкой.
7. Продвинутые приемы: выделение по условию и макросы
Для автоматизации выделения используйте условное форматирование или макросы.
Выделение по условию:
- Выделите диапазон, который нужно проанализировать.
- Перейдите в
Главная → Условное форматирование → Правила выделения ячеек. - Задайте условие (например, «больше 1000») и стиль выделения (например, красный фон).
Excel автоматически подсветит ячейки, соответствующие критерию. Чтобы выделить только эти ячейки, используйте Перейти → Выделить… → Условные форматы.
Макросы для выделения:
С помощью VBA можно создавать кастомные правила выделения. Например, этот код выделит все ячейки с ошибками (#Н/Д, #ЗНАЧ! и т.д.):
Sub ВыделитьОшибки()
Dim rng As Range
For Each rng In Selection
If IsError(rng.Value) Then
rng.Interior.Color = RGB(255, 100, 100) ' Красный фон
End If
Next rng
End Sub
Чтобы запустить макрос, нажмите Alt + F8, выберите ВыделитьОшибки и кликните Выполнить.
⚠️ Внимание: Макросы работают только в файлах с расширением .xlsm (с поддержкой макросов). При открытии такого файла Excel может показать предупреждение о безопасности — разрешите выполнение макросов только если доверяете источнику.
FAQ: Частые вопросы о выделении в Excel
Можно ли выделить ячейки на разных листах одновременно?
Да, но с ограничениями. Удерживайте Ctrl и кликайте по вкладкам листов, которые нужно выделить. Затем выделите диапазон на активном листе — он будет применен ко всем выбранным листам. Важно: изменения (например, форматирование) также применятся ко всем листам!
Почему при выделении большого диапазона Excel «подвисает»?
Это связано с пересчетом формул или слишком большим количеством условных форматов. Попробуйте:
- Отключить автоматический пересчет (
Формулы → Параметры вычислений → Вручную). - Удалить ненужные условные форматы (
Главная → Условное форматирование → Управление правилами). - Разбить большой диапазон на несколько меньших.
Как выделить все пустые ячейки в диапазоне?
Используйте функцию Перейти → Выделить… → Пустые ячейки. Альтернативно, примените фильтр по пустым значениям (Данные → Фильтр → Пустые), затем выделите видимые ячейки.
Можно ли сохранить выделенную область для будущего использования?
Да, с помощью именованных диапазонов (см. раздел 4) или закладок:
- Выделите область.
- Нажмите
Вставка → Закладка(илиCtrl + Shift + F2). - Задайте имя закладке (например,
Отчет_Март). - Чтобы вернуться к выделению, нажмите
F5→ выберите имя закладки.
Почему при выделении ячеек с формулами показываются не значения, а сами формулы?
Скорее всего, включен режим отображения формул. Чтобы вернуть отображение значений, нажмите Ctrl + ` (гравис) или перейдите в Формулы → Показать формулы (снимите галочку).